| 原因 | 解决方案 |
|---|---|
| 高玩家并发 | 增加服务器容量或优化服务器性能 |
| 网络延迟 | 优化网络连接或使用 CDN |
| 游戏代码优化不当 | 优化游戏代码以减少资源使用 |
| 服务器硬件能力不足 | 升级服务器硬件或增加服务器数量 |
| 恶意攻击(如 DDoS) | 采取安全措施,如 DDoS 保护 |
| 服务器过载 | 限制同时在线玩家数量或分流负载 |
| 数据库查询优化不当 | 优化数据库查询并使用索引 |
| 内容加载过慢 | 优化内容加载速度,例如使用 CDN 或压缩 |
| 外部因素(如 ISP 故障) | 与 ISP 合作解决问题或寻求替代连接 |
专业角度介绍:什么原因致使游戏服务器卡顿
游戏服务器卡顿通常是由以下因素引起的:
高玩家并发:当服务器上同时在线的玩家数量过多时,服务器可能无法处理所有 incoming 请求,导致玩家体验到延迟和卡顿。
网络延迟:如果服务器和玩家之间的网络连接不稳定或速度较慢,玩家可能会遇到延迟和数据包丢失,从而导致卡顿。
游戏代码优化不当:如果游戏代码没有针对高性能进行优化,它可能会过度消耗服务器资源,导致卡顿。
服务器硬件能力不足:如果服务器硬件不具备足够的计算能力、内存或存储空间来满足游戏的需求,它可能会导致卡顿。
恶意攻击:DDoS 攻击或其他恶意行为可能会淹没服务器,使其无法正常运行,从而导致卡顿。
服务器过载:如果服务器同时处理过多任务,例如同时运行多个游戏实例或处理大量数据库查询,它可能会导致卡顿。
数据库查询优化不当:如果游戏频繁执行未优化的数据库查询,它可能会导致服务器数据库变慢,从而导致卡顿。
内容加载过慢:如果游戏需要加载大量内容,例如纹理、音频文件或游戏模型,则加载缓慢可能会导致卡顿。
外部因素:诸如 ISP 故障或网络拥塞等外部因素可能会导致玩家的网络连接中断,从而导致卡顿。

点赞 (3765) 收藏 (3765)